Gukesh defeats Carlsen, leads the Grand Chess Tour
The SuperUnited Rapid & Blitz Croatia 2025 aka Grand Chess Tour Zagreb 2025, part of the Grand Chess Tour, is scheduled for June 30 to July 7, 2025, in Zagreb, Croatia, at The Westin Zagreb Hotel. This is the third leg of the 2025 Grand Chess Tour, marking its 10th anniversary, and features a 10-player round-robin tournament with a $175,000 prize fund. The star of the day in the Grand Chess Tour was Gukesh, who started the day tied for first with Carlsen, Wesley So, and Jan-Krzysztof Duda, won all his games in day 2: against Nodirbek Abdusattorov, Fabiano Caruana, and Carlsen. This marked his fifth consecutive victory, giving him a two-point lead over second-placed Duda, who had 8 points. Carlsen, Wesley So, Ivan Saric, and Anish Giri followed with 6 points each.
The victory of Gukesh against Carlsen unleashed a storm of comments on social media, as previously Carlsen has stated that he does not expect much from the current World Champion in the fast paced Grand Chess Tour. Garry Kasparov went as far as saying, “Very important victory for Gukesh and a very important day. Now we can question Magnus’s domination. It is not just a second loss. It is a convincing loss.” Gukesh himself said, “Beating Magnus is always special”
